Compact combined twin window and floor fan housing

Description
FIG. 1 is a perspective view of the top, front, and right side of a compact combined twin window and floor fan housing showing my new design. In FIG. 1, supporting feet which are seen only in FIGS. 2, 3, 5 and 7, are pivoted to a retracted position for use in a window opening;
FIG. 2 is a front elevational view thereof;
FIG. 3 is a rear elevational view thereof;
FIG. 4 is a top plan view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a bottom plan view thereof;
FIG. 6 is a right side elevational view thereof. The left side elevational view is identical; and,
FIG. 7 is a perspective view thereof similar to FIG. 1 but showing the housing with supporting feet extended for free-standing use.
